Falling Can. A painter is standing on scaffolding that is raised at constant speed. As he travels upward, he accidentally nudges a paint can off the scaffolding and it falls 15.0 m to the ground. You are watching. and measure with your stopwatch that it takes 3.25 s for the can to reach the ground. Ignore air resistance. (a) What is the speed of the can just before it hits the ground? (b) Another painter is standing on a ledge, with his hands 4.00 m above the can when it falls off. He has lightning-fast reflexes and if the can passes in front of him, he can catch it. Does he get the chance?

(a) What is the speed of the can just before it hits the ground?
Given data,
Height of the scaffolding from ground, H= 15 m
Acceleration due to gravity, a= g = 9.8
Time taken by paint can to reach ground, t= 3.25 s
To find,
Speed of can just before it reaches ground=?
